NURBURGRING ROUND 4

For Round 4 of the Belgium Clio Cup Championship the Team endured a fraught week with transporter problems and a 13 hour journey to the world famous Nurburgring track in Germany.

It was always going to be a tough weekend with a German contingent entering this as a ‘one off’ race and benefiting from local knowledge of the circuit itself. The Team were however confident after the recent run of lackluste results and were looking forward to their Third World Series by Renault encounter. These events draw vast crowds and the German’s are particularly knowledgeable and enthusiastic when it comes to Motorsport.

With only seven laps of free practice run on the Friday and no knowledge of the circuit, Rob was pleased to be in 15th place of the 28 runners. There was genuine optimism of being able to qualify for the first time this season and in the top ten.

For qualifying the team had not taken into account the possibility of oil pressure problems as well as an increase in pace from their competitors. The team were therefore disappointed to qualify towards the end of the field and while both Chris and Jason set to work in eliminating the engine problems, Rob spent more time on learning his way around this particularly difficult Grand Prix race track. It was interesting to note that the boys from Advent Motorsport were also struggling with a lack of pace, due again to a lack of local track knowledge.

In what was a rather processional Renault Clio race Rob was enjoying a mid field battle, but made a small mistake going into turn six and understeered off into the gravel. Although he was able to extricate himself from the gravel and continue to fight his way through the pack, he finished in a lowly 20th position.

For the second race, in what was a good battle between five cars for a position in the mid field, the oil pressure problems returned dropping him down to an eventual 19th place.

Team RSA are however building a valuable database of knowledge about these foreign circuits and this will hopefully leave them well placed to battle in 2009 when they hope to run a two or three car team in this hugely competitive Championship.
